2. If you're going to be there, you should probably take care of the ball joints. Please see (2). If you want to install the large seal, you need the seal install tool. That tool, I mean seriously, you need it. A tool will protect the seal from damage when it's installed without one.
In response to the people who say these parts do not fit, they will fit a Ford superduty axle model 2005 or later. This new dust shield is an improvement over previous versions. There are differences between this and original equipment manufacturer. My 2007 F250 SRW front axle was perfectly sized to fit in this part.
